The Los Angeles Clippers have extended the contract of American forward Kawhi Leonard, according to the club’s official National Basketball Association (NBA) website.
Terms of the new agreement were not disclosed. Lenard has been with the Clippers since 2019. In 2021, the basketball player signed a 4-year contract worth $176.3 million and is expected to earn $48.8 million in the 2024/25 season.
“We are very excited to continue our relationship with Kawhi.” He is an elite player, a great teammate and a tireless worker who knows how to win and makes it his top priority. Our club has grown since his arrival. We are fortunate that Kawhi decided to join the Clippers five years ago and we are excited to continue our journey together,” said Lawrence Frank, Clippers President of Basketball Operations.
This season, the 32-year-old American played 32 regular season games for the Clippers, averaging 23.8 points, 6.1 rebounds and 3.4 assists.
Leonard was drafted 15th overall by Indiana in 2011. He is a two-time NBA champion with San Antonio (2014) and Toronto (2019), a two-time Finals MVP, a five-time NBA All-Star and two NBA Defensive Player of the Year.
